[Je ré-envoie, j'ai l'impression que ce n'est pas passé]

Le 14/06/06, Marc Siramy <[EMAIL PROTECTED]> a écrit :

> effectivement c'était la chose à faire :-) !!

Aaah :)

> par contre le make ne passe pas :
> *** Warning: Linking the shared library libfilelight.la against the
> *** static library ./radialMap/libradialmap.a is not portable!

Bizarre, j'ai le même message d'erreur, mais le make se poursuit sans
sourciller et ld ne râle pas comme pour toi :

> /usr/bin/ld: ./radialMap/libradialmap.a(widget.o): relocation
> R_X86_64_32 against `a local symbol' can not .


 
> Le make génère également un tas de warning du genre :
> /usr/lib/qt3//include/private/qucom_p.h:403: warning: ‘struct
> QUType_double’ has virtual functions but non-virtual destructor .

J'ai les mêmes, je ne suis pas sûr que ce soit lié au problème
précédent.


> Je pense que cela témoigne d'une mauvaise écriture de qt3 :
> http://blogs.msdn.com/oldnewthing/archive/2004/05/07/127826.aspx .
> "The problem with knowing when to make your destructor virtual or not
> is that you have to know how people will be using your class."
> 
> Je suppose qu'il vaut mieux créer un destructeur virtuel qui ne serve
> rien plutot que de ne pas en créer un qui aurait été plus qu'utile.
> 

Bah, euh, j'avoue mon incompétence en C++...


-- 
Christophe Gaubert
http://ch4tn01r.free.fr/blog
Participez à la liste Avis de citoyens :
http://fr.groups.yahoo.com/group/Avis_de_citoyens/
=========================================
Vous souhaitez acquerir votre Pack ou des Services Mandriva?
Rendez-vous sur "http://store.mandriva.com";.
Rejoignez le club mandrake : http://www.mandrivaclub.com
=========================================

Répondre à